Selling on Afternic requires an Exchange Membership which usually
costs $9.95 a year. However, to encourage you to sell mykidscloset.com
with Afternic, we are offering you a free one-year Exchange Membership.
With this membership, you can list an unlimited number of domains for
sale on Afternic. Afternic receives a 10% sales fee (minimum fee $60)
if a domain is sold on our exchange.

If you're not sure about accepting this offer, consider accepting
this offer "or best offer". We will show your Closing Soon listing
to about 40,000 people per day on our home page and on all Afternic
parked pages to solicit a better offer. If you do not receive a better
offer, this offer will be automatically accepted seven days after the
offer was made. To qualify for the free Exchange Membership, you must
accept this offer or use our "or best offer" feature to sell mykidscloset.com.

[Edit]: I didn't read the post well:

The Best offer feature is new to me and really doesn't allow for a counter offer and in a sale of this nature. I dont' see it being of the same value to the open market.

Basically you would be selling the domain for $430.05 after all the fees. I fthis price fits your needs then sell.

You may want to decline the offer and join Afternic.com and set an asking price that would be of more to your liking. Please keep in mind that this may not lead to a sale. I've blown many sales this way but I have managed to get my desired price months down the road. If you have any domain stats to see if people are looking at the domain that would influence my decision as well.
